Digital Desk: A man was reportedly trampled to death after being crushed by an elephant in Balipara.

The incident occurred at the Cotton Mill in Balipara’s Chariduar Village in Sonitpur. The deceased was identified as Debeswar Mech.

The terrifying incident occurred when the deceased went to feed the elephant bananas.

Recently, a 32-year-old man from Dhing in Nagaon was trampled to death by a rogue elephant separated from his herd in another incident of man-elephant conflict.

The incident occurred in Tinsukia district of Upper Assam's Khatangpani range, near Tarani reserve forest, under Doomdooma forest division.

The deceased was identified as Jamir Uddin.
